He left his last breath in a car accident rapper Ernesto Enrique Carralero, who became known as OhTrapstar. Carralero was a rising rapper who had more than 114,000 followers on Instagram and had become better known for his track “Choppa” in 2017, which garnered more than 10 million views on YouTube.
The 23-year-old rapper from Florida was one of the three people who lost their lives in Miami on Wednesday morning (26/5), as announced by the police.
The driver lost control and crashed into a house in the area. He then turned over and was engulfed in flames. Its causes rolling stock remain unclear and are being investigated.
«What woke me up was the wall that fell on me while I was sleeping. As soon as I woke up I saw the fire“Jackner Surlin, who lives at home, told NBC Miami. Police identified the three victims as Bayle Pricilla Bucceri, 23, Candido Miguel Barroso-Nodarse, 22, and Ernesto Enrique Carralero, 23, according to People.
